Description:
2-Aminopurine CEP, with the CAS number 178925-41-2, is a synthetic analog of adenine, a purine nucleobase. This compound is characterized by the presence of an amino group at the 2-position of the purine ring, which influences its biological activity and interaction with nucleic acids. It is often used in molecular biology and biochemistry as a mutagen and as a tool for studying DNA replication and repair mechanisms. 2-Aminopurine can incorporate into DNA and RNA, potentially leading to mispairing during replication, which can result in mutations. The compound is typically soluble in water and organic solvents, making it versatile for various experimental applications. Additionally, it exhibits properties that allow it to act as a competitive inhibitor of certain enzymes involved in nucleotide metabolism. Its use in research is significant for understanding genetic processes and the effects of mutagens on cellular functions. However, safety precautions should be taken when handling this compound due to its potential biological effects.
